Petts Wood station is designed to offer utmost convenience, and it shows through its extensive list of facilities. The ticket office is open from 5:45 AM to 8:00 PM on weekdays, making it effortless to buy or collect tickets. There's ample support for travelers with mobility challenges, as the station boasts step-free access and accessible ticket machines situated across the location. Though there aren't accessible toilets, thorough staff assistance is available around the clock to aid travelers.
While waiting for your train, you can relax in heated waiting rooms available from early morning to early evening. There are refreshment facilities, including a coffee kiosk, ensuring you don't miss your caffeine fix. If cycling is more your speed, you'll find space for 40 bicycles, ensuring secure racks even though CCTV coverage is absent.
Travel doesn't end when you arrive at Petts Wood station — rather, it's where possibilities begin. From the station, there are several ongoing transport connections. For those heading toward Orpington, buses run from Bus Stop B on Queensway. If Bromley South or Chislehurst is your destination, head to Bus Stop C. Nestled in the serene locale of Aughton, West Lancashire, Town Green train station provides a pleasant and efficient service for travelers venturing throughout the region. Whether you're commuting to the bustling heart of Liverpool or embarking on a peaceful trip to Ormskirk, Town Green stands as a gateway to explore the dynamic areas connected by the renowned Merseyrail network. This station, though lacking some facilities found in larger terminals, offers critical services to ensure a smooth journey for every passenger.
Essential for any traveler is understanding the ticketing options. Town Green unfortunately does not have a ticket office or ticket machines, though tickets bought online can be easily collected here. Travelers will be pleased to find the station equipped with smartcard validators, making it convenient for regular commuters to hop on and off trains with ease. While the station lacks accessible ticket machines, an induction loop is available for those with hearing impairments, ensuring inclusivity.
Accessibility is at the forefront of Town Green’s design with step-free access throughout, making navigation easier for those with mobility challenges. While there are no accessible toilets or extensive refreshment facilities, seating areas are present for the comfort of passengers as they wait for their trains.
If you’re planning onward travel, you’ll find a blend of options. While there isn't a taxi rank at the station, public buses are readily available. For more detailed information on bus routes, visit Merseytravel’s website. For air travelers, Liverpool John Lennon Airport is the nearest airport. Conveniently, combining train and bus tickets can streamline the trip from any Merseyrail station to the terminal by simply requesting tickets to "Liverpool John Lennon Airport". From Liverpool South Parkway, you can catch buses for the final leg of the journey to the airport.
